Kinds Of Office Copy Paper
When choosing copy paper for a workplace setting, it is essential to understand the various types readily available. The following table provides an overview of typical kinds of copy paper:
| Type of Copy Paper | Weight (GSM) | Characteristics | Common Uses |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standard Copy Paper | 70-80 GSM | Light-weight, affordable, good print quality | Everyday printing, memos, files |
| Premium Copy Paper | 90-120 GSM | Thicker, smoother surface, vibrant colors | Reports, discussions, marketing materials |
| Recycled Copy Paper | 70-100 GSM | Made from recycled materials, environmentally friendly | General workplace use, environmentally-conscious companies |
| Colored Copy Paper | 70-120 GSM | Readily available in different colors | Color coding, leaflets, statements |
| Shiny Photo Paper | 200-300 GSM | High gloss finish, lively color recreation | Photos, expert discussions |
| Cardstock | 200-300 GSM | Thick and strong, is available in numerous surfaces | Business cards, postcards, invites |
Factors to Consider When Choosing Copy Paper
Selecting the right copy paper can substantially affect the quality of printed materials and overall office efficiency. Here are some elements to take into consideration:
1. Weight and Thickness
The weight of paper, typically measured in grams per square meter (GSM), affects its density, quality, and sturdiness. Lighter papers (70-80 GSM) are normally more cost-effective and suitable for routine jobs, while heavier papers (90-120 GSM) are perfect for professional documents and discussions.
2. Brightness
The brightness of paper affects the contrast of printed texts and images. A greater brightness level (measured as a portion) results in better presence and sharper colors. For general workplace use, a brightness level of 90% or greater is advised.
3. Complete
The surface of the paper can identify the appearance and feel of printed files. Common finishes include:
- Smooth: Ideal for text-heavy documents.
- Textured: Adds a tactile element, often used for expert reports.
- Shiny: Enhances color saturation, ideal for images.
4. Eco-Friendliness
With a growing emphasis on sustainability, lots of organizations prefer eco-friendly paper choices made from recycled materials. These options often maintain quality while lowering the environmental impact.
5. Compatibility with Printers
It's necessary to think about the kind of printers utilized in the workplace. Some paper types work much better with inkjet printers, while others are designed for laser printers. Making sure compatibility can avoid paper jams and printing mistakes.

Tips for Storing and Handling Office Copy Paper
Proper storage and handling of copy paper can prevent damage and preserve quality. Consider the following suggestions:
- Store Flat: Keep paper in a flat position to avoid curling and warping.
- Avoid Humidity: Store paper in a cool, dry environment to avoid wetness absorption, which can result in paper jams.
- Avoid Direct Sunlight: Exposure to light can trigger fading and wear and tear of paper quality.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the very best weight for daily printing?
For everyday printing, basic copy paper weighing between 70-80 GSM is generally sufficient. It is cost-effective and sufficient for many workplace needs.
2. Can I utilize colored copy paper in a printer?
Yes, colored copy paper can be utilized in printer, but it's necessary to verify compatibility ahead of time. Always examine the paper's requirements or seek advice from the printer's handbook for finest results.
3. What is the distinction between copy paper and printer paper?
While both types of paper can often be used interchangeably, printer paper usually refers to higher-quality paper optimized for printing. Copy paper is normally lighter and more cost-effective, suitable for daily use.
4. Is recycled paper as great as virgin paper?
Recycled paper quality differs by brand name and manufacturing process. Premium recycled documents can carry out comparably to virgin paper, but businesses ought to think about specific needs and conduct tests to guarantee quality.
5. What can I make with remaining paper?
Leftover paper can be recycled for drafts, notes, or brainstorming sessions. Companies can also donate excess paper to schools or community organizations that may need it.
